Registrations open for the Lennox Head Strategic Plan Community Reference Group

Are you passionate about your community’s future? Ballina Shire Council is calling on locals who live or work in Lennox Head or Skennars Head to register their interest to join a Community Reference Group.

Lennox Head has undergone significant change over the last decade. New subdivisions and housing we see today were planned for in the 2002 Lennox Head Community Aspirations Strategic Plan.

Council has resolved to make a new Lennox Head Strategic Plan 2023-2043 which will cover Lennox Head and Skennars Head from Fig Tree Hill in the North to the southern edge of the Aureus Estate in the south.

The Community Reference Group will play an important role in shaping this new strategic plan. The group will brainstorm the implications of key planning choices for the area and map these issues with Council staff. Members will also be in a prime position to offer and champion ideas to be developed into actions in the plan.

Planning choices are often tough because favouring one outcome can impact another due to the constrained nature of places. For example, a planning choice for more car parking could impact on available public land, or a planning choice for a new commercial area could have negative environmental impacts.

The Community Reference Group will help Council clarify the values and preferences of the Lennox Head community to inform the future planning choices that will make it into the new Lennox Head Strategic Plan.

It is important that a diversity of voices is represented on the Community Reference Group. Selection of members will be based on the following criteria:

  • Geographic location – Where members live or work
  • A balance of business and community representatives
  • Connections with local community groups
  • A diversity of ages and backgrounds
  • Purpose for participation

Spaces will be limited. Members will be required to attend at least three out of five sessions to be held between June and September 2022. Each session will run for 2-3 hours.
